GUJARATI SAMAJ OF DETROIT 2007 ANNUAL ESSAY COMPETITION ENTRY FORM

www.GSOD.org/essay

To promote and preserve our culture, Gujarati Samaj of Detroit organizes various events and activi-ties throughout the year for its members. To promote our language and to encourage our youth to display their writing skills, we are introducing the Annual GSOD Essay Competition. The competition is open for GSOD members and their immediate family. GSOD would like to provide a platform for its members to bring out their literary talents and it is our sincere hope that you will participate with great enthusiasm. Following are the ‘rules and guidelines’ for the competition.

Competition will be held in three age groups as follows:

Group A: 8 – 12 years Group B: 13 – 18 years Group C: 19+ years

Competition is open to current GSOD members and their immediate family only.

There is a limit of one entry per person.

The essay may be written in Gujarati or English, preferably in Gujarati.

A list of suggested topics for each age group is below.

The essay should be between 1,000 and 1,500 words; double spaced on 8.5” x 11” size paper. All pages must be properly

numbered, titled and stapled together on the top left corner.

The essay must be submitted as an individual effort and must be original work of the author. Any evidence of plagia-rism will immediately disqualify the entry from the competition.

The essays will be assessed in confidence by an independent panel of judges. Judges’ decision will be final. Essays will be judged based on the following criteria:

Content relates to the topic.

Essay has a logical development (flow), and ideas are organized appropriately.

Quality of description (creativity, clarity, etc.).

Mechanics such as grammar, spelling, punctuation, neatness, etc.

How effectively candidate can portray his / her views and thought.

Originality (e.g. a parent should not be writing the essay for a child).

All essays become the property of Gujarati Samaj of Detroit and will not be returned. GSOD reserves the right to edit and publish the essays.

All entries must be mailed to the address listed on the other side and must be postmarked no later than Friday, Octo-ber 19, 2007.

Entries that do not comply with any of the competition rules will be disqualified.

GSOD will not be responsible for lost, late, mutilated, incomplete or illegible entries and/or any condition caused by events beyond the reasonable control of GSOD which may cause the competition to be cancelled.

To ensure anonymity, it is important that the author’s name does not appear anywhere on the essay. Please fill out the form on the back (page 2) in its entirety and mail it with the essay. Do not staple the form to the essay.

Group A My most favorite Indian festival / holiday. OR How I spent my Summer Break.

Group B Our Culture and its role in my life. OR That was the best vacation of my

Group C “C” in “A B C D” (American Born Confused Desi) – truth or myth ? OR What does “Gujarati” mean to me ?
